Guillaume Boivin is set to make his first-ever appearance in the Tour de France as one of the eight selected riders for Israel Start-Up Nation this year.

“Guillaume has had a strong season and he will be one of the main helpers for our GC riders in this Tour. The plan is for G to stay close to Mike [Woods], keeping him out of trouble while also helping to set up him – or one of our other leaders – for a potential stage win. He’s an important part of our selection”, sports manager Rik Verbrugghe explained.

After over a decade in the professional peloton, Boivin can’t wait to finally line up at the start of the biggest race of them all.

“For me, it’s a dream come true being able to go to the Tour de France. It’s something every pro cyclist wants to do in their career. All the hard work I’ve put in is now paying off. I’m really proud to do the Tour with Israel Start-Up Nation, especially with the team we have this year”, Boivin said.

“My main focus will be to protect our GC guys. Already in the first week, there are some great stages for us. Every Grand Tour is always very stressful in the opening week but from what I hear, it’s even more hectic in the Tour. Firstly, I’ll focus on getting our leaders safely through the first week and then, I’ll see how the race evolves.”
